What rank is 01 in the Navy?

What rank is 01 in the Navy?

ensign
O-1 through O-4 are junior officers: ensign, lieutenant (junior grade), lieutenant, and lieutenant commander. O-5 and O-6 are senior officers: commander and captain. O-7 through O-10 are flag officers: rear admiral (lower half) (one star), rear admiral (two star), vice admiral (three star), and admiral (four star).

What does 1 star mean in the Navy?

An officer of one-star rank is a senior commander in many of the armed services holding a rank described by the NATO code of OF-6. Officers of one-star rank are either the most junior of the flag, general and air officer ranks, or are not considered to hold the distinction at all.

What is ENS Navy rank?

Navy/Coast Guard Ranks

Pay Grade Title Abbreviation
O-1 Ensign ENS
O-2 Lieutenant, Junior Grade LTJG
O-3 Lieutenant LT
O-4 Lieutenant Commander LCDR

What is ensign in the Navy?

Ensign is the first commissioned officer rank. Candidates receive this rank after completing their commissioning through the United States Naval Academy (USNA), Navy Reserve Officer Training Corps (NROTC) or Officer Candidate School (OCS).

What is the lowest rank in the Navy?

Seaman is a naval rank and is either the lowest or one of the lowest ranks in most navies around the world. In the Commonwealth, it is the lowest rank in the navy.

What do the Navy ranks really mean?

In the United States Navy , a rate is the military rank of an enlisted sailor , indicating where an enlisted sailor stands within the chain of command, and also defining one’s pay grade.However, in the U.S. Navy , only officers carry the term rank , while it is proper to refer to an enlisted sailor’s pay grade as rate.   • What rank is senior chief in Navy?

    Senior chief petty officer is the eighth of nine enlisted ranks in the U.S. Navy and U.S. Coast Guard, just above chief petty officer and below master chief petty officer , and is a noncommissioned officer. They are addressed as “Senior Chief” in most circumstances, or sometimes, less formally, as “Senior”.
